Across tax years 2023–2025, 28 private foundations reported 32 grants totaling $198,799 to 24 organizations in Indio, California. The most-funded purposes were human services (4 grants) and community & economic development (3 grants). Edeltraud Mccarthy Foundation Inc gave the most by reported dollars — $30,000 across 1 grant. The median reported grant was $5,000.
